The Early Life of Charlie Puth

Born on December 2, 1991, in Rumson, New Jersey, Charlie Puth showed an early affinity for music. His mother, a music teacher, played a pivotal role in nurturing his talent, introducing him to classical music and teaching him the piano at the tender age of four. This early exposure to music was instrumental in shaping his artistic sensibilities.

Growing up, Puth faced challenges, including a near-fatal dog bite incident at age two that left him with a permanently scarred eyebrow. However, these obstacles did not deter his musical aspirations. He attended the Rumson-Fair Haven Regional High School, where his passion for music flourished. During his high school years, Puth participated in jazz ensembles and took part in a summer youth jazz ensemble at Count Basie Theatre’s Cool School in Red Bank, New Jersey.

Puth’s talent was undeniable, and by the age of 12, he was already writing and selling his own Christmas album titled “Have a Merry Charlie Christmas.” This early venture into songwriting and producing hinted at the remarkable career that was to unfold. His YouTube channel started in September 2009 and became a platform for him to showcase his musical abilities, covering a wide range of songs and eventually catching the attention of a broader audience.

Charlie Puth’s First Singles

Charlie Puth’s transition from an online sensation to a mainstream artist is a significant chapter in his musical journey. His early career was marked by a blend of talent and timely opportunities that catapulted him into the spotlight. The big break came when he signed with Atlantic Records in early 2015, a move that set the stage for his first major single and album releases.

Puth’s debut single, “Marvin Gaye,” featuring Meghan Trainor, was released in February 2015. This song, with its catchy tune and throwback vibe to the classic Motown sound, quickly resonated with audiences. It not only showcased Puth’s smooth vocal abilities but also his knack for creating engaging, memorable melodies. The track became a commercial success, topping charts in various countries and signaling the arrival of a new pop music sensation.

Following the success of his debut single, Puth’s first album, “Nine Track Mind,” was released in January 2016. This album was a showcase of his versatility as an artist, featuring a mix of pop, soul, and R&B influences. It included hits like “One Call Away” and “We Don’t Talk Anymore,” featuring Selena Gomez, which further cemented his status in the music industry. These songs not only received critical acclaim but also achieved significant commercial success, with “We Don’t Talk Anymore” becoming particularly popular globally.

Charlie Puth’s Second Album: “Voicenotes”

The release of Charlie Puth’s second album marked a pivotal moment in his career, showcasing his evolution as an artist and solidifying his place in the music industry. Titled “Voicenotes,” this album, released in May 2018, was a departure from the sound of his debut album, reflecting a more mature and refined musical style.

“Voicenotes” was heavily influenced by Puth’s personal experiences and musical inspirations. It featured a more sophisticated sound, with elements of funk, pop, and R&B, and was entirely produced by Puth himself. This creative control allowed him to craft a sound that was authentically his, resonating with his artistic vision and musical influences. The album’s lead single, “Attention,” became an instant hit, showcasing Puth’s ability to create catchy yet emotionally resonant music. The song’s success was followed by other popular tracks like “How Long” and “Done For Me,” featuring Kehlani, which further demonstrated his versatility as an artist.

“Voicenotes” received critical acclaim for its production quality and lyrical depth. It was seen as a significant step forward in Puth’s career, with critics praising his growth as a songwriter and producer. The album’s success was not just critical but also commercial, as it debuted at number 4 on the US Billboard 200 and received a Grammy nomination for Best Engineered Album, Non-Classical.

Through “Voicenotes,” Puth established himself not just as a pop singer but as a multifaceted musician with a deep understanding of music production and songwriting. This album reflected his journey of self-discovery and artistic exploration, marking a new chapter in his career. 

Charlie Puth’s Third Album: “Charlie”

Charlie Puth’s artistic journey took a compelling turn with the release of his third studio album, “Charlie,” an endeavor that further showcased his evolution as a musician. This album marked a distinct shift in Puth’s musical direction, reflecting a deeper and more personal approach to his artistry.

Released after the success of “Voicenotes,” the third album diverged from the upbeat pop tracks that initially defined Puth’s career. Instead, it offered a more nuanced exploration of themes such as love, loss, and self-reflection. The lead single from this album set a new precedent, combining Puth’s signature melodic prowess with a more introspective lyrical style. This track, along with the rest of the album, illustrated Puth’s growing maturity as a songwriter and his ability to connect with his audience on a deeper level.

Critically, the album was well-received, with reviewers highlighting Puth’s growth as an artist and his skillful blend of various musical genres. The production quality of the album also received accolades, showcasing Puth’s evolving talent as a producer. It featured a mix of slower ballads and upbeat numbers, each song telling a story, reflecting Puth’s journey and experiences.

Commercially, the album enjoyed success, resonating with fans and charting internationally. It underscored Puth’s versatility and his knack for crafting songs that appeal to a broad audience while still maintaining a sense of personal authenticity.
